How to calculate interest rates using education loan calculators

Various banks and financial institutions in India offer education loans for students pursuing specialized services within the country and abroad. These banks and financial institutions generally release a list of permitted courses and educational institutions for which these education loans are granted.

 

The interest rate on education loans  in India generally includes 1.5 to 2 percent of the principal loan amount added to the existing marginal cost of lending rate (MCLR). Education loan interest rates in India start from as low as 11.25 per cent of the principal amount.

 

●      The process for calculating education loan EMIs

To calculate the education loan interest rate for a particular month, divide your interest rate by the number of payments to be made that year. For instance, if your interest is 6 per cent per annum and you make 12 payments a year, you need to divide 0.06 by 12. This will give you the figure of 0.005. Multiply this number by your remaining loan balance to find out how much you'll pay in interest that month.

 

●      Using calculators for quick and accurate results

Interest rates on education loans are also calculated using education loan calculators. These calculators are simple online tools like normal calculators. To use them, students need to first visit the bank’s or financial institute’s website and locate the tool on it.

 

After locating the tool, students just have to fill in a few details about their loan amount, the tenure for which the loan has been secured and the rate of interest. After filling in these details, students have just click on the submit button. Within seconds, they will have your monthly EMI amount displayed on your screen.

 

Students can also try different combinations and permutations of the loan amount, tenure and rate of interest to find the most suitable repayment plan. They can modify the variables according to their budgetary requirements. Using an education loan calculator guarantees quick and accurate results for students.

 

●      Other types of calculators available for students

Knowing their exact EMIs can help students devise their repayment plan accurately. They can plan their monthly budgets to accommodate the monthly payment of their EMIs.

Students can also use expense calculators to estimate the exact loan amount they would require for the entire duration of your course. This will prevent them from

 burrowing more than they can afford to repay.

 

Another useful tool for students is the education loan repayment calculator that provides estimates that are used by students to plan their repayment strategies. The results of these calculators are based on a standard repayment plan that involves paying a fixed amount every month for a set number of months, based on the student’s loan term and his current prepayment status. The calculator works on a fixed interest rate and assumes that the student’s loan is currently in repayment.


Using an education loan calculators is easier than doing the calculations mentally or even on a computer. The tool helps students make better repayment plans for their education loans.
